N = Clearance above a roof shall extend a minimum of 24” (610 mm) above the highest point when it passes through the roof

surface, and any other obstruction within a horizontal distance of 18” (450 mm).

1 In accordance with the current CSA-B149 Installation Codes
2 In accordance with the current ANSI Z223.1/NFPA 54 National Fuel Gas Codes
* Clearance to a mechanical air supply refers to an HRV or other mechanical device that brings fresh air into the living space, not a fresh air for an
appliance combustion.
† A vent shall not terminate directly above a sidewalk or paved driveway which is located between two single family dwellings and serves both dwellings
‡ only permitted if veranda, porch, deck or balcony is fully open on a minimum 2 sides beneath the floor:
NOTE: 1. Local codes or regulations may require different clearances.

2. The special venting system used on Direct Vent Fireplaces are certified as part of the appliance, with clearances tested and approved by the

listing agency.

3. CFM Corporation assumes no responsibility for the improper performance of the appliance when the venting system does not

meet these requirements.
